...I want to try a Thermold anybody have any experience with them?...

If you're referring to the 30/45 round Thermold...

YMMV, but I have a couple, and they're absolutely reliable. I'll add, though, that they're two out of six that I bought, and the other four weren't.

They're "emergency backups" only, now, to my DPMS 45's, which are all 100%...
